intel / DRI2: Track and flush front-buffer rendering

Track two flags:  whether or not front-buffer rendering is currently
enabled and whether or not front-buffer rendering has been enabled
since the last glFlush.  If the second flag is set, the front-buffer
is flushed via a loader call back.  If the first flag is cleared, the
second flag is cleared at this time.
